Kordsa is among the partners of the EU-funded efficient plastic recycling project “PolynSPIRE”

Thermoplastic materials based on fossil fuels such as PP, PE, PET, PA are used in a vast range of products and applications in everyday life but also generate an ever-increasing amount of plastic waste. Insufficiency of the current waste management system in terms of the separation of plastic blends and composites, and heterogeneous variant structure of plastic wastes are the main challenges for plastic waste recycling.
Kordsa is among the 21 partners, including research/academic institutions, governmental organization, industries and SMEs, of the EU-funded Horizon 2020 Project “PolynSPIRE” which aims to demonstrate a set of innovative, and sustainable solutions for efficient plastic recycling. The project addresses three innovation pillars which are implemented in operational environments reaching TRL 7 in 48 months: chemical recycling, mechanical recycling and valorization.
